President arrives in Kathmandu for SAARC Summit
[January 4, 2002
- 6.00 GMT]

President Chandrika Bandaranaike Kumaratunga leading a Sri Lankan delegation arrived in Kathmandu Thursday, to take part in the 11th Summit of the South Asian Association for Regional Cooperation beginning Friday. 

Prime Minister of Nepal Sher Bahadur Deuba welcomed the Sri Lankan President at the VVIP Lounge of Tribhuwan International Airport. Also present on the occasion were the Sri Lankan Foreign Minister, Tyronne Fernando, Secretary to the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Mr. G Wijayasiri and Sri Lanka’s Ambassador in Nepal, Mrs. Pamela J. Deen.

A contingent of the Royal Nepal Army presented a guard of honor to the distinguished guest and the National Anthems of both countries were played. Five young girls welcomed Kumaratunga by offering bouquets.

The Chief Justice, The Speaker, The Chairman of the National Assembly, the Chairman of the Raj Parishad Standing Committee and the Leader of the main Opposition Party in Nepal were also present at the airport to greet President Kumaratunga.

Minister-in-waiting Sharat Singh Bhandari, Minister of State for Foreign Affairs Arjun Jung Bahadur Singh, high-ranking officials of the Nepali government, The Royal Nepal Army and the Nepal Police were also present on the occasion.
